Is January a good time to go to Egypt?

January is a wonderful time to go just about anywhere in Egypt. Unlike the balmier parts of the year when the southern regions can be unbearably hot, the entire country is pleasant in January. With daytime highs in the 60s to 70s countrywide, it's hard to go wrong.

What is the warmest month in Egypt?

JulyAverage monthly temperaturesThe hottest month of the year is July with an average daily maximum of 39 C and an average low of 29 C. The coolest month of the year is January with an average daily maximum of 22 C and an average low of 12 C.

Can you go to the beach in Egypt in January?

The sea water is 74°F on average (min: 71°F/max: 77°F) so you can easily spend time in the water. Swimming in january in Alexandria, El-Arich, Marsa Matruh, Baltim, El Zaranik, Ras Sudr and Damietta is possible but the sea is generally cool.

What is the coldest month in Egypt?

JanuaryThe lowest temperature will be in January and it rarely drops below 39.2 °F (4°C). The hottest temperature will be in August and will get up to 113 °F (45°C).

What is the best month to visit Egypt?

The best time to visit Egypt is between October and April when daytime temperatures are comfortable and nights are cool, but you're still guaranteed sun. The conditions are perfect for exploring chaotic Cairo or venturing into the desert.

What is the weather like on the Nile cruise in January?

It's pretty mild at this time of year, but it's a good idea to bring along a jumper or light jacket for the evenings. The average daily maximum is 22 C and the average daily minimum is 12 C.

What is the busiest month to visit Egypt?

Tourists can travel to Egypt any time of the year. The best time to visit Egypt is during winter from October to April, when temperatures are lower. The most popular time for tourist is December and January. Tourism in Egypt is booming this time of the year so make sure you plan in advance.

What is the cheapest month to visit Egypt?

It is cheapest to visit Egypt during the low season or summer months (May to August). But if you want value for your buck then the shoulder months of March, April and September are ideal for Egypt. Do US citizens need a visa for Egypt?

U.S. citizens must have a visa to enter Egypt. U.S. citizens can obtain a renewable single-entry 30-day tourist visa on arrival at Egyptian airports for a 25 USD fee. A multiple entry visa is also obtainable for 60 USD. The Government of Egypt has created a website for the issuance of “e-visas.”
